Wednesday 4-15-20, Nisan 21 5780, 4th. day of the weekly cycle, 27th. Spring day
7th. Day of Unleavened Bread/Crossing The Red Sea, 6th. Day of The Omer Count
Yesod of Chesed Bonding in Loving-Kindness
Psalm One Nineteen:41-48, John Fourteen:23
Psalm One Nineteen:41-48
VAU
41 Let thy mercies come also unto me, O LORD, even thy salvation, according to thy word. 42So shall I have wherewith to answer him that reproacheth me: for I trust in thy word. 43And take not the word of truth utterly out of my mouth; for I have hoped in thy judgments. 44So shall I keep thy law continually for ever and ever. 45And I will walk at liberty: for I seek thy precepts. 46I will speak of thy testimonies also before kings, and will not be ashamed. 47And I will delight myself in thy commandments, which I have loved. 48My hands also will I lift up unto thy commandments, which I have loved; and I will meditate in thy statutes.
John Fourteen:22-23
22Judas saith unto him, not Iscariot, LORD, how is it that thou wilt manifest thyself unto us, and not unto the world?
23Jesus answered and said unto him, If a man love me, he will keep my words: and my Father will love him, and we will come unto him, and make our abode with him.
For love to be eternal it requires bonding. A sense of togetherness which actualizes the love in a joint effort. An intimate connection, kinship and attachment, benefiting both parties. This bonding bears fruit; the fruit born out of a healthy union.
Exercise for the day: Start building something constructive together with a loved one.
